Summary     : A X front-end for the Ghostscript PostScript(TM) interpreter
Description :
GNU gv is a user interface for the Ghostscript PostScript(TM) interpreter.
Gv can display PostScript and PDF documents on an X Window System.

Update Information:

- Fix NULL access segfault bug when opening zoom with no file (bug 1071238)
- Fix bounding box recognition with CR line terminators
